20130093166 | GOLF BAG CART - A golf bag cart includes a body for engaging a golf bag. The body has a first longitudinal end and an opposite second longitudinal end. A first pair of wheels is rotatable about a first axis of rotation at or adjacent the second longitudinal end, a second pair of wheels rotatable about a second axis of rotation which is pivotable relative to the body between a folded position and an outstretched position. When the second axis of rotation is in the outstretched position, the first and second wheel pairs support the body in a slanted orientation. When the second axis of rotation is in the folded position, the first and second wheel pairs support the body in a generally horizontal orientation. When the second axis of rotation moves from the outstretched position to the folded position, the second axis of rotation moves away from the first axis of rotation. | 04-18-2013 |

20130167731 | ATTACHMENT FOR A TEA KETTLE - An attachment for a container for the preparation of an extraction beverage comprises a base plate mounted horizontally on the container, having an aperture for an extraction product container to pass through, and a lifting apparatus which comprises a sleeve. The lifting apparatus has a guide fixed to the base plate for guiding the sleeve in a direction perpendicular to the base plate. The lower position defines a brewing position of the sleeve and the upper position defines an inoperative position. A locking apparatus locks the sleeve in the brewing position. A timer is also provided for operating the locking apparatus so that after a predefinable time period the sleeve is unlocked when it is locked in the brewing position. The sleeve is acted on by a restoring force to move from the brewing position to the inoperative position when the sleeve is unlocked. | 07-04-2013 |

20090318054 | Inflatable ball with predictable movements - A ball having an inflatable ball shell within which is found an inflatable inner ball partially filled with an inner ball gas and partially filled with a liquid that is held in the center of the inflatable ball shell by an inflatable support when the inflatable inner ball, the inflatable ball shell and the inflatable support are inflated. The ball exhibits an eccentric and unpredictable motion unless a concomitant spin is appropriately applied to it and the motion of the ball is primarily determined by movement of the liquid within the inflatable inner ball. The inflatable support can be a donut-shaped chamber having an inner radius which is substantially the same as, and may be attached to, an outer radius of the inflatable inner ball. Alternatively, the inflatable support can be three or more elastic spherical shells attached to the inflatable inner ball. | 12-24-2009 |

20090067165 | CANOPY LIGHT - A canopy lighting device comprising a body having a light source and a base that magnetically couples to the body. The body and the base can be located on opposite sides of a fabric sheet to magnetically clamp the lighting device to the fabric sheet. The base may have an energy source, first electrical connection features coupled electrically to the energy source, and first magnetic connection features. The body may have a light source, second magnetic connection features for cooperating with the first magnetic connection features to clamp the body to the base, and second electrical connection features. The second electrical connection features cooperate with the first electrical connection features of the base when the body and the base are clamped together. | 03-12-2009 |
20120224047 | VISUAL INSPECTION DEVICE - A visual inspection device includes a body having a support portion and a grip portion extending from the support portion. The device also includes a flexible cable having a first end portion coupled to the body and a second end portion, and a camera assembly coupled to the second end portion of the flexible cable. The camera assembly includes an image sensor operable to transmit image data through the flexible cable. The device further includes a display supported by the support portion of the body. The display is electrically connected to the flexible cable to display image date from the image sensor. The device is powered by a rechargeable battery pack removably coupled to the body. | 09-06-2012 |

20110103763 | SYSTEM AND METHOD FOR IDENTIFYING, PROVIDING, AND PRESENTING SUPPLEMENTAL CONTENT ON A MOBILE DEVICE - The present invention is embodied in a system for synchronizing a mobile device with video output by a video output device. In one embodiment, the system comprises a data reader, a remote control, and a router. The data reader is configured to be connected to a video output device for reading digital codes associated with video or audio signals output by the video output device. The remote control has a user input mechanism and is configured to transmit an activation signal to the data reader after activation of the user input mechanism. The router is configured to be connected to a wide area network for transmitting data from the data reader to a remote data server. The router is also configured to establish a local data connection between the data reader and a mobile device. The data reader, after receiving an activation signal from the remote control, is further configured to transmit data indicative of a digital code or series of digital codes read by the data reader to the remote data server via the router. Additionally, the data reader, after receiving a request signal from the mobile device, is further configured to transmit data indicative of a digital code or series of digital codes read by the data reader to the mobile device via the router. | 05-05-2011 |

20110211275 | Method of determining flying height of magnetic head - For obtaining a flying height of a magnetic head from a magnetic disk, the magnetic head being placed in a slider arranged at an interval with the magnetic disk, an initial setting process and a flying height detecting process are performed. In the initial setting process, driving power to a heater is increased gradually, from a state where the heater arranged at a position in proximity to the magnetic head in the slider is not driven, until the magnetic head makes contact with the magnetic disk. Then, in each stage, an electrical resistance value of the sensor arranged at a position in proximity to the magnetic head in the slider, which is increased due to the heat from heater, and either an approach distance of the magnetic head toward the magnetic disk or the flying height of the magnetic head from the magnetic disk are acquired. Then, basic data is prepared by obtaining the relationship between a variation of the electrical resistance value of the sensor and the flying height of the magnetic head from the magnetic disk, which is obtained in each stage or which calculated from the approach distance in each stage. In the flying height detecting process, an electrical resistance value of the sensor is determined, and a variation of the electrical resistance value is calculated from the determined values. Then, the flying height of the magnetic head from the magnetic disk in the state where the electrical resistance value was determined is obtained based on the basic data obtained in the initial setting process, using the calculated variation of the electrical resistance value. | 09-01-2011 |

20150353865 | CENTRIFUGATION DEVICE AND METHODS FOR ISOLATION OF BIOMASS FROM ALGAE MIXTURE AND EXTRACTION OF OIL FROM KITCHEN RESIDUE - A centrifugation device includes a feeding tube defining a longitudinal axis, and a plurality of centrifugal plates extending longitudinally and radially around the feeding tube and rotatable about the longitudinal axis. The centrifugal plates have coarse surfaces coated with one or more layers of polymer material. A centrifugation tank is disposed coaxially with the feeding tube and around the centrifugal plates. A sidewall of the tank is provided with micro/nano filters. Methods for isolation of algal biomass from an algae and aqueous mixture, and extraction of oil from kitchen residue and/or microalgae are also disclosed. | 12-10-2015 |

20100225299 | WALL SCANNER - Embodiments of the invention relate to a wall scanner that includes a housing, a plurality of sensors, a display, and a control section. The housing includes a handle portion and a body portion. The handle portion is adapted to receive a removable and rechargeable battery pack such as a high-voltage lithium-ion (“Li-Ion”) battery pack. The body portion of the housing encloses the plurality of sensing devices, such as, for example, capacitive plate sensors for sensing the presence of a stud behind a surface, a D-coil sensor for identifying the presence of metal behind the surface, and a non-contact voltage sensor for detecting the presence of live wires carrying AC currents. The display is configured to display, among other things, the location of an object behind the surface in real-time, the depth of an object behind the surface, and whether an object behind the surface is ferrous or non-ferrous. The control section includes a plurality of actuation devices for controlling the functions and operations of the wall scanner, such as the scanning mode. | 09-09-2010 |

20090097509 | Laser Apparatus - This utility model discloses a type of laser apparatus comprising a back mirror, a YV04 crystal, a Q-SW crystal, a front mirror, an optical pumping source, an optical fiber splice, a directional light-regulating lens and a laser head. The back mirror is a plano-concave lens, the incidence point of optical pumping source is deviated from the end surface center of YV04 crystal by 0-2 mm; under the back mirror there is a back mirror regulator; under the Q-SW crystal there is a Q-SW crystal regulator; above the front mirror there is a lens regulator; the laser head is located in front of the back mirror, the directional light-regulating lens is set in front of the laser head, the optical fiber splice is set in front of the directional light-regulating lens and under the lens there is a lens regulator. During use, the optical pumping source may generate two laser resonance paths, thus the laser conversion can be improved, Nd—YV04 is heated uniformly; Because there are two laser resonance paths, so the laser cavity length has a wide range of application: 40 mm-200 mm, in such a way that the technical difficulty in manufacturing the laser cavity is reduced. | 04-16-2009 |
